Types of Wooden Pallets
Presenting a robust structure that can deal with different loads, wooden pallets been available in different designs and requirements. Here is a table highlighting the most common kinds of wooden pallets and their features.
Kind Of Wooden PalletDescriptionLoad CapacityPerfect UseStringer PalletBuilt with three or more parallel stringers supporting deckboards, making it ideal for heavy loads.2,000-- 6,000 lbsGeneral shipping and storage (heavy products)Block PalletFeatures vertical blocks linking the Top Wooden Pallets and bottom deckboards, permitting for entry on all 4 sides.2,500-- 4,000 poundsGrocery and retail sectors (forklift accessibility)Double-Face PalletBoth sides have deckboards, providing it additional resilience.2,500-- 4,000 poundsRecyclable transport of itemsSingle-Face PalletAn easier style with deckboards on one side, mainly used for lightweight products.1,000-- 2,500 lbsShowing items in retail or lightweight shippingEuro PalletAbides by European standard sizes and regulations, recognised for its resilience and reparability.1,500-- 2,500 lbsInternational shipping and standardizationUsage Across Industries

To optimize the life-span of wooden pallets, appropriate care and maintenance are essential. Here are some practical ideas:
Regular Inspections: Routinely inspect for indications of damage or wear, such as splinters, fractures, or broken boards.Avoid Overloading: Adhere to weight limits to prevent structural failure and lengthen resilience.Store Properly: Keep pallets dry and off the ground to avoid wetness absorption and rot.Clean Regularly: Periodically clean pallets to remove dirt and debris, specifically if they managed food.Repair as Needed: Fix damaged boards or loose nails without delay to guarantee their performance.Common Myths About Wooden Pallets
In the middle of their usefulness, several misconceptions persist about wooden pallets that can result in confusion. Here are a few typical misconceptions exposed:

Myth: Wooden Pallets Are Unsafe for Food Use
Fact: When properly treated and kept, wood pallets can be used safely in food transport. Try to find heat-treated (HT) pallets that meet safe requirements.
Myth: All Pallets Are the Same
Reality: There are different types and styles of wooden pallets customized for particular usages, making them far from uniform.
Misconception: Wooden Pallets Are Not Eco-Friendly
